Default Steering Wheel Options

Anyone know if the Cherokee sport steering wheel fits the wangler's of around the same period?

Finding it hard to get a 97 TJ steering wheel, looks like I can get Cherokee steering wheels from around 2000 with the airbag reasonably easily and cheap. Only real difference I can see is the aribag part is a little smaller to allow the buttons on the side for cruise control, if the air bag will plug into the wrangler without issue and the steering wheel will bolt on then it seems like a no-brainer to get one as a substitute.

Can anyone advise if this is fine to do
